"Taking Back Sunday – Academy, Dublin"

"...Earlier in the evening, the unusual aroma of Clearasil and nail polish fill the air as Limerick based The Demise take to the stage. Admitting that they don’t stick to a set-list and appearing to follow drummer Kieran Hayes’ lead, the foursome bash out some tight tunes to a warm reception. They share a sound somewhat similar to early 00’s American Exports (Sum 41, The Offspring, Yellowcard), albeit with lyrics that are as epic and over-the-top as early Metallica, which is not necessarily a bad thing. They too are vocally affected by heavy American accents which is not an endearing quality, at least not for an Irish band, but that aside they do have the calibre of songs and talent to suitably entertain the attentive audience." - State Magzine

Bio

The Demise are a four-piece punk rock band from Limerick, Ireland who bring a distinctive blend of melodic, thrashing guitars, wild drums and strong harmonies to the scene, unlike any that has been heard in Ireland for many years now. So listen up because you won't want to miss a single note!

Over the course of their three years together - which has taken them from around Ireland across to Europe as far as Germany - they have released two EP's and one single and played support to many great bands including Rise Against, Taking Back Sunday, Capdown, Supersuckers, Gang Green, Twin Atlantic, New Bruises, The Dangerfields, Giveamanakick, Messiah J and The Expert, The Corona's and many more.

2009 has been the bands most successful year to date with the band playing with American punk heavyweights Rise Against and Taking Back Sunday in both Dublin and Belfast after being invited by the bands during their respective tours.

Plans for the rest of the year include the release of the band's debut full-length album and their first UK tour.
